Han So Hee injured her face while filming her drama with Park Seo Joon


Han So Hee injured her face hard while filming her new drama.

The young woman is currently filming a new drama for Netflix titled “Gyeongseong Creature” alongside Park Seo Joon.

“Gyeongseong Creature” is a thriller set in the spring of 1945 and tells the story of two young adults having to face a creature and have to fight for their survival.

Park Seo Joon will take on the role of Jang Tae Sang, a rich man from Bukchon who is shrewd and resourceful. A sociable man, he also became an emblematic figure of Bukchon.

As for Han So Hee, she will play the role of Yoon Chae Ok, who searches for missing people. From a young age, she learned to navigate life with her father as they traveled through Manchuria and Shanghai. Having survived terrible situations, she is skilled with firearms, knives and all kinds of machines.

On August 3, the media reported that the young woman had suffered facial injuries on the set of “Gyeongseong Creature”.

According to the media, she was injured while filming a very difficult action scene, and should have been taken to the emergency room because the injury was near her eye and could require an operation.

Following this, 9ato Entertainment took the floor.

The actress’ agency said: “Today, Han So Hee suffered a facial injury while filming ‘Gyeongseong Creature’. Luckily, it’s not a major injury. She is not in a state requiring an operation. Even though the shooting schedule is not going to be impacted, we will have to keep an eye on the situation and on her condition to make sure she gets enough rest because it is a facial injury.
